Decision to exit retail driven by 'excitement we have for our B2B operations', CEO Richard Leeds claims

Misco parent Systemax is shuttering the majority of its retail empire as it looks to devote its attentions to its B2B operations. The NYSE-listed firm has announced it is closing 31 of its 34 US...
